The MIT Licensing would let 1 just change that redirecting bit to RM, & republish, though 1 would have to change some resources (new app & package name, & different images, &c).  The most difficult part might be putting together the actual build environment.

 

Unfortunately, the original dev has no interest in RM.

A couple reasons for open-source:

- It could potentially be included in F-Droid (if appropriately licensed), thereby increasing RM's reach

- Users who are devs (I'm not :classic_wink:) could help with feature requests &/or bug fixes. (e.g.:  Using app as pure redirector, allowing to open in user's choice browser or using app to open RM links)
